How Our Contaminated Water Cleanup Service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your property is thoroughly cleaned and restored. We’ll start by assessing the extent of the damage, identifying the source of the contamination, and developing a customized plan to address it. Our technicians will then use specialized equipment to remove standing water, dry out the affected area, and disinfect and deodorize the space.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a trained technician to your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the contamination. They’ll take note of the affected areas, the type of water involved, and any potential health risks. This information will help us develop a customized plan to address the damage and prevent further contamination.

Step 2: Water Removal

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your property. This may involve using pumps, vacuums, or other tools to extract water from your basement, crawl space, or living areas.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After removing the standing water,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area. This may involve using dehumidifiers, air movers, or other tools to reduce moisture levels and prevent further damage.

Step 4: Disinfection and Deodorization

Once the area is dry, we’ll disinfect and deodorize the space to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This may involve using specialized cleaning solutions or equipment to remove any remaining contaminants.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

After completing the cleanup and restoration process, we’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and healthy. We’ll also remove any debris or equipment used during the process.

Warning Signs You Need Contaminated Water Cleanup

Catching contaminated water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the road. Look out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your home or business can show the presence of mold or bacteria.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ains or Warping on Floors or Walls

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or warping on your floors or walls.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
